Heart Of Stone

Genre: Crime, Thriller
Director: Tom Harper
Cast: Gal Gadot, Jamie Dornan, Alia Bhatt

Gal Gadot

Get ready for an adrenaline-fueled ride as Netflix brings us “Heart Of Stone.” This action-packed thriller, directed by Tom Harper, stars the talented Gal Gadot, Jamie Dornan, and Alia Bhatt. Gadot portrays Rachel Stone, an intelligence operative on a mission to protect a valuable and dangerous asset. With high-stakes action and a gripping storyline, “Heart Of Stone” promises to keep audiences on the edge of their seats.

The Monkey King

Genre: Animation
Director: Anthony Stacchi
Cast: Jimmy O. Yang, Stephanie Hsu, BD Wong, Jodi Long

Monkey King Animation 2023

Prepare to embark on an epic quest with “The Monkey King,” an animated film that combines action, comedy, and fantasy. Directed by Anthony Stacchi, this family-friendly adventure follows the journey of a mischievous monkey and his magical fighting Stick as they face off against gods, demons, dragons, and the greatest enemy of all – Monkey’s own ego! With a talented voice cast including Jimmy O. Yang, Stephanie Hsu, BD Wong, and Jodi Long, “The Monkey King” is sure to enchant viewers of all ages.

You Are So Not Invited To My Bat Mitzvah!

Director: Sammi Cohen
Cast: Idina Menzel, Jackie Sandler, Adam Sandler, Sadie Sandler, Sunny Sandler, Samantha Lorraine, Dylan Hoffman, Sarah Sherman, Dan Bulla, Ido Mosseri, Jackie Hoffman and Luis Guzman

Cast of You Are Not Invited To My Bat Mitzvah

Adam Sandler fans, rejoice! “You Are So Not Invited To My Bat Mitzvah” is a hilarious new comedy based on the book by Fiona Rosenbloom. Directed by Sammi Cohen, this star-studded film features Idina Menzel, Jackie Sandler, Adam Sandler, and the Sandler family – Sadie, Sunny, and Samantha. Get ready for a wild ride as two friends’ plans for epic bat mitzvahs take a comedic turn when they vie for the attention of the same boy. With a stellar cast and Sandler’s signature humor, this movie is bound to be a hit.

Choose Love

Genre: Romantic Comedy, Interactive
Director: Stuart McDonald
Cast: Laura Marano, Avan Jogia, Jordi Webber and Scott Michael Foster

Still from Choose Love

Prepare to make choices in “Choose Love,” an interactive romantic comedy directed by Stuart McDonald. This unique film allows viewers to decide the romantic fate of the protagonist, Cami Conway, played by Laura Marano. Using Netflix’s interactive software, which was previously featured in the popular series “Black Mirror: Bandersnatch,” viewers can shape the story by selecting romance choices for Cami. With a talented cast including Avan Jogia, Jordi Webber, and Scott Michael Foster, “Choose Love” offers a truly immersive and personalized viewing experience.

Ehrengard: The Art of Seduction

Genre: Romantic Comedy
Director: Bille August
Cast : Sidse Babett Knudsen, Mikkel Boe Følsgaard, Jacob Lohmann, Emilie Kroyer Koppel
Language: Danish

From Denmark comes “Ehrengard: The Art of Seduction,” a highly anticipated romantic comedy directed by Bille August. Based on the best-selling book by Karen Blixen, this enchanting film follows the story of a self-appointed love expert who tries to teach a timid prince the art of seduction. However, their plan backfires, leading to scandal and unexpected romance. With a stellar Danish cast, including Sidse Babett Knudsen, Mikkel Boe Følsgaard, Jacob Lohmann, and Emilie Kroyer Koppel, “Ehrengard” is set to captivate audiences with its charm and wit.

Once Upon a Crime

Genre: Comedy, Adventure
Director: Yuichi Fukuda
Cast: Kanna Hashimoto, Yuko Araki, Takanori Iwata
Language : Japanese

Once Upon a Crime

Join Little Red Riding Hood on a thrilling adventure in “Once Upon a Crime,” a Japanese comedy directed by Yuichi Fukuda. In this whimsical tale, Little Red Riding Hood finds herself in the middle of a mystery while attending a royal ball with Cinderella. Can she solve the case before the clock strikes midnight? With a talented Japanese cast including Kanna Hashimoto, Yuko Araki, and Takanori Iwata, “Once Upon a Crime” promises laughter, excitement, and a fresh twist on a beloved fairy tale.

Love at First Sight (fka The Statistical Probability of Love at First Sight)

Genre: Romance
Director: Vanessa Caswill
Cast: Haley Lu Richardson, Ben Hardy, Jameela Jamil, Rob Delaney, Sally Phillips

Love at First Sight

Indulge in a heartwarming romance with “Love at First Sight,” a film that explores the possibility of finding love in unexpected places. Directed by Vanessa Caswill, this enchanting story features Haley Lu Richardson and Ben Hardy in the lead roles. After missing her flight from New York to London, Hadley meets Oliver in a chance encounter at the airport, sparking an instant connection. However, upon landing at Heathrow, they are separated, and finding each other in the chaos seems impossible. Will fate intervene to bring them back together? “Love at First Sight” is a tale of serendipity, love, and the power of second chances.

Spy Kids: Armageddon

Genre: Kids, Comedy
Director: Robert Rodriguez
Cast: Zachary Levi, Billy Magnussen, Gina Rodriguez

Spy Kids

The beloved “Spy Kids” franchise returns with “Spy Kids: Armageddon,” directed by Robert Rodriguez. Join the young spies on a thrilling adventure filled with comedy and excitement. Starring Zachary Levi, Billy Magnussen, and Gina Rodriguez, this action-packed film follows the next generation of Spy Kids as they face their most dangerous mission yet. Get ready for gadgets, gizmos, and family fun in this highly anticipated sequel.

The Magician’s Elephant

Genre: Animation
Director: Wendy Rogers
Voice Cast: Noah Jupe, Mandy Patinkin, Natasia Demetriou, Benedict Wong, Miranda Richardson, Aasif Mandvi

Magicians Elephant

Prepare for a magical journey in “The Magician’s Elephant,” an enchanting animated film directed by Wendy Rogers. Based on the beloved children’s book, this heartwarming tale follows the adventures of a resilient orphan boy guided by a mystical elephant. Voiced by a talented ensemble including Noah Jupe, Mandy Patinkin, Natasia Demetriou, Benedict Wong, Miranda Richardson, and Aasif Mandvi, “The Magician’s Elephant” is set to captivate audiences with its stunning visuals and captivating storytelling.
